Arthur gave us this review on 10/04/04.

Approx Dates of Stay: August 20 -24 2004. Overall Campground Rating: horrible. What stood out? Unproffesionalism and unfreindlyness greeting from the moment you arrive. Owners and Staff: The most unfreindly, roudest, unprofessional, disrespectful and unhappy person I've ever come accross in my life. Camp landscaping and surroundings: Fair, hard to tell due to some rain. Made everything muddy.

Overall Site Quality: fair-average. Campsite hookups: electric, water, sewer, Part time electric, very little water pressure. Campsite Descriptions: wooded, grassy bottom, fire ring

Activities and Amenities: lake, swimming, fishing, boating, camp store, pets allowed, What is nearby? grocery stores, retail stores, ocean or lake, nature trails.
